Elemental Description[]
The control of plants is the basic fundamentals of the Nature Element. The manipulation or generation of vines, wood, leaves, and other flora bears a variety of uses; strong and possibly thorny vines to trap and ensnare, razor-edged leaves to slash and slice, sturdy wood and bark to serve as armor or a shield, dense foliage to shroud and conceal... Nature is quite a versatile Element as a result, but doesn't really excel in any one category, making it a jack-of-all-trades.
Nature's intrinsic ties with life and growth allow for more skilled users to draw upon this energy to boost their healing factor and even heal minor wounds; on the more physical side, this allows for the creation of medicinal plants and herbs for healing or other uses, and can also be used to intensify or alter the natural qualities of plants, such as causing flora to grow faster or in different ways.

- Fire - A Nature wielder's ability to summon vines, thorns, etc. is generally rendered useless against a Fire wielder, as plants are quite flammable; a battle between a Fire wielder and a Nature wielder typically ends up one-sided as a result. Even a strong Nature wielder can be troubled by a novice Fire wielder, and often the former's only hope for victory is that the weather is not on the Fire wielder's side.
- Ice - Plantlife is often ill-equipped to deal with frigid temperatures and ice, and Ice's offensively-oriented nature allows it to rip through any vines or leaves or whatnot that a Nature wielder can manifest, even easily cracking through bark armor. Even a high-level Nature wielder can be troubled by a novice Ice-wielder, and often the former's only hope for victory is that the weather is not on the Ice wielder's side.
- Metal - There's simply no contest here; Metal wielders will rip through anything a Nature wielder can throw at them without breaking a sweat. Even the sharpest leaves and vines are incapable of leaving a scratch against basic Metal-element defensive techniques.
